Rakesh Guha

Rakesh Guha is a guitarist from Kolkata, India where he’s a part of an Indie Band called Loch Lomond. Being a self taught guitar player, a lot of his time was spent figuring out songs from listening to them. Hailing from a part of the world where traditional music is highly appreciated, his band and friends are constantly trying to redefine music coming from India.

Posts by Rakesh Guha